The first quarter 2008 money is rolling into the campaign coffers in record numbers. Hillary Clinton set a first quarter record by raising $26 million. She rolled another $10 million into her funds from her Senate account, giving her $36 million. Meanwhile, John Edwards raised over $14 million. Bill Richardson picked up $6 million for the primaries and $5 million for the general. Joe Biden has raised $3 million and has another $3.6 he can roll over from his Senate coffers. Chris Dodd raised $4 million and rolled over another $5 million. And the Republicans are expected to announce their millions shortly.
